About HammondCare

HammondCare is an independent Christian charity that exists to improve quality of life for people in need.

We specialise in aged and dementia care, palliative care, rehabilitation, mental health services for older people, and other related health and aged care services.  HammondCare seeks to embed evidence based best practice in its services and we provide these services through home care, sub-acute hospitals and residential aged care. 

Bringing these health, hospital and aged care services together, HammondCare has been able to develop innovative, flexible care models designed to serve people with complex health or aged care needs, regardless of their circumstances.

About the role

A Specialised Dementia Carer (SDC) is a multi-skilled role, providing personalised care to residents living with dementia in accordance with HammondCare’s philosophy of care and values. SDCs provide care and support to residents, enabling them to engage in life within the home. SDCs assist with the full range of duties including personal care, maintenance of the cottage (eg. cooking, cleaning, laundry) and provide opportunities for residents to engage in activities of daily living (eg. participation in domestic tasks), leisure activities and wider community involvement. 

The rationale for having a multi-skilled staff model is to ensure that residents’ needs are met when they arise, and that disruptions to residents are at a minimum, with familiar staff tending to all the residents’ needs.  This approach reduces the need for multiple people to provide different aspects of care, which can lead to increased levels of confusion and agitation for a person living with dementia.

All SDCs work together as a team to give each resident the opportunity to succeed at activities of daily living.  We promote dignity and self-respect and aim to maintain the resident’s quality of life and abilities. An SDC models appropriate behaviour and encourages a calm, supportive and secure atmosphere.
